SigParser is looking for a driven DevOps engineer who wants to have a major impact on the business.

We are a fast growing B2B SaaS startup that extracts, enriches, and acts on relationship data from email and calendar systems. Our customers are sales, marketing, and business development teams at law firms, consulting firms, financial services companies, and other relationship-driven businesses. We are growing quickly and need someone who can help us ship high quality software faster and keep our production environment running smoothly.

Location: Carlsbad, CA

Salary range: $115,000 to $150,000, depending on experience.

What You'll Do

  • Own the release process end to end: deploy code to production and make sure it lands cleanly
  • Monitor production logs and proactively catch errors before customers notice them
  • Diagnose and resolve performance issues across our backend and database layer
  • Upgrade and maintain our PostgreSQL database servers, and manage the full data lifecycle including retiring old customer databases safely
  • Build backend tooling (with Claude Code) that gives the whole team better visibility into customer issues
  • Build data quality monitoring so we can spot problems in the data we extract and enrich before they reach customers
  • Maintain our SOC 2 posture and security compliance using tools like Vanta
  • Test PRs before they merge, and help shepherd changes through QA

What We're Looking For

  • Attention to detail
  • Vision for how to improve processes and systems
  • System administration
  • Some coding experience (.NET/SQL)
  • Cloud monitoring experience
  • Experience with CI/CD pipelines and release management
  • Experience monitoring production systems and triaging log data

Nice to Have

  • Vanta experience
  • AWS experience or certifications (Cloudwatch, S3, Security...)
  • C#/.NET/JavaScript/SQL
  • Postgresql experience
  • Terraform or other infrastructure as code experience
  • Background in a small startup environment where you wore multiple hats

The Logistics

This is an in-office position in Carlsbad, CA. You will work alongside the rest of the engineering team five days per week. We believe a small, co-located team ships faster and learns faster, and we have built our culture around that.

You must already be authorized to work in the United States. We are not able to sponsor visas (including H-1B) for this role.

Security and Trust

We handle highly sensitive customer data, and we take that seriously. We are SOC 2 certified, and you will help us stay that way. You will practice secure coding using established best practices such as OWASP, and security will be a normal part of how you review and ship code. Because of the nature of the data you will have access to, this role requires a background check.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
